From e4ac2d4acc8cb44df2107e3fa1067755feaaa005 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Rick Hudson Date: Tue, 16 Feb 2016 17:16:43 -0500 Subject: [PATCH] [dev.garbage] runtime: replace ref with allocCount This is a renaming of the field ref to the more appropriate allocCount. The field holds the number of objects in the span that are currently allocated. Some throws strings were adjusted to more accurately convey the meaning of allocCount.
